- 締切済み
SSLのログファイルを【1ファイル/Day】に設定したい
SSLのログファイル形式はデフォルトで、全てのログは1つのファイルに書く込む設定になっています これを、毎日1個のログファイルを吐き出す設定に変えたいのですが、方法を教えていただければ幸いです ■環境 ―――――――――――― RedHat Linux6J Apache 1.3.27 openssl-0.9.7 mod_ssl-2.8.12-1.3.27 ―――――――――――― Apacheのログファイルを、下記の指定で、毎日ワンファイル吐き出すようになっています(1行): CustomLog "|/usr/local/apache/bin/rotatelogs /usr/local/apache/logs/access%Y%m%d_log 86400 540" combined SSLのログファイル設定の部分は、下記のようになっています(2行): CustomLog /usr/local/apache/logs/CustomLog_request_log \ "%t %h %{SSL_PROTOCOL}x %{SSL_CIPHER}x \"%r\" %b" この部分の修正になるのでしょうか。もし、そうであれば、具体的に修正方法を教えていただければ、幸いです どうぞよろしくお願いいたします
- みんなの回答 (1)
- 専門家の回答
みんなの回答
- kusukusu
- ベストアンサー率38% (141/363)
回答No.1
邪道かもしれませんが、私はメールログをcronを使って一日ごとに分けています。 mvで、適当なディレクトリに移した後、echo > /var/log/pop_log としています。
お礼
参考になりました。どうもありがとうございました。 下記の方法で、ログのローテートができることを知りました: CustomLog "|/usr/local/apache/bin/rotatelogs /usr/local/apache/logs/ssl_request%Y%m%d_log 86400 540" "%t %h %{SSL_PROTOCOL}x %{SSL_CIPHER}x \"%r\" %b" これからも、どうぞよろしくお願いいたします